  • 1. WRITING A LETTER Dr. Roman Pathak, 0416081000 http://www.smartielts.org
  • 2. PARTS OF A LETTER http://www.smartielts.org
  • 3. http://www.smartielts.org • Greeting • Introduction • Formal • Identity • Identifier • Purpose of the letter • Informal • Exchange pleasantries • Purpose
  • 4. • Body • Address the task mentioned in the question in order as per the question • Closing/Closure • Thanking • Closing http://www.smartielts.org
  • 5. Types of Letter http://www.smartielts.org • Request • Explain • Apology • Complaint • Suggestion • Invitation
  • 6. Examples Question Type a To a holiday camp to ask about accommodation for a group of children http://www.smartielts.org Information b To your friend to tell her that you cannot visit her next month as planned Apology c To you local council saying how you think their services can be improved Suggestion d To ask your tutor to attend a party to celebrate your graduation Invitation e To tell your school why you have decided to withdraw from your course Explanation f To a restaurant about a rude waiter and some bad food Complaint
  • 7. Greetings Formal Informal http://www.smartielts.org Dear Sir Dear Madam Dear Sir/Madam Dear Sir or Madam Dear Sally Dear Bruce Dear Mum Dear Mr. Sam Dear Mrs. Affleck Dear Ms. Smith
  • 8. Identification Formal Informal I am a student at I was a client I am a regular customer http://www.smartielts.org I’m Thank you for letter/invitation I hope everything is fine with you Thanks for inviting me I am writing this letter in regards to I am writing this letter to express my concern/satisfaction/dissatisfaction I need to tell you that…. I need a favour from you. I’m sorry but can you please…..?
  • 9. Apologizing • Formal • I am extremely sorry http://www.smartielts.org about • I would like to apologise about • I owe you an apology • I sincerely apologize for the inconvenience arising from this • Informal • I'm sorry about… • I am sorry that… • I'm very sorry about… • I'm very sorry for… • Please forgive me for...
  • 10. Asking for Help • Formal • I would be grateful if you could… • I would appreciate it if you could… • I would like to request you to…… http://www.smartielts.org • Informal • Could you please… • I was wondering if you could …… • I would like to know….. • I am writing to ask about
  • 11. Asking for Information • Formal • I am writing to enquire about… • I would like to know about/if… http://www.smartielts.org • Informal • I am writing to find out about... • What I am looking for is...
  • 12. Complaining / expressing dissatisfaction • Formal • I'm writing to express my dissatisfaction with… http://www.smartielts.org • Informal • I'm writing to tell you about my annoyance with… • I am not happy about... • ...was very disappointing.
  • 13. Expressing satisfaction • Formal • I am writing to express my satisfaction with • I would like to inform you that I am extremely contended with http://www.smartielts.org • Informal • I was delighted to hear that… • I was very happy to learn that… • I was thrilled to find out that... • I was glad to hear that… • ...was very enjoyable.
  • 14. Expressing concern / sympathy • Formal • I am writing to express my concern about.. http://www.smartielts.org • Informal • I am sorry to hear about... (your accident/ illness)
  • 15. Giving bad news Formal • I regret to advise you that...(formal) http://www.smartielts.org • Informal • I regret to inform you that… • I am sorry to tell you that… • I am afraid I have some bad news.
  • 16. http://www.smartielts.org Invitation • Formal • I would like extend an invitation to you on the occasion of …. • Informal • Would you like to….? • I would like to know if you would…..
  • 17. Giving Suggestion • Formal • I would like to recommend (to this abc) • I feel obliged to advise/recommend/s uggest that http://www.smartielts.org • Informal • Why don’t we….? • How about ……?
  • 18. http://www.smartielts.org Thanking • Formal • I am extremely grateful for… • I very much appreciate your ______ing • No words can express my gratitude. • Informal • Thanks • Thank you. • Thank you very much. • Thanking you kindly. • Thanking you in anticipation • I can't thank you enough. • I am thankful to you for all your support and cordiality
  • 19. http://www.smartielts.org Closing • Thanking in anticipation • I look forward to seeing you. • I look forward to hearing from you. • I look forward to meeting you.
  • 20. http://www.smartielts.org Closure Formal Informal Yours sincerely Yours faithfully Love Best wishes All the best See you soon Warm Regards
  • 21. http://www.smartielts.org Explaining • What this means is • In other words, • That is to say • To be more precise • Specifically saying • In fact,
  • 22. Giving Examples • For example, • For instance, • A good illustration of this is • If we take an example • Evidence for this is provided by •We can see this when http://www.smartielts.org
  • 23. Giving Reasons • One reason for this is • The immediate cause of this • One of the causes of this is http://www.smartielts.org
  • 24. Example Sentences • I believe I owe you an explanation for this • Should you have any questions regarding this, you can contact me via email(xyz@gmail.com) or on my phone (0000000) • For your information • As I understand from the information provided • I think, I deserve special consideration • I had not been informed http://www.smartielts.org
  • 25. • These work experiences have greatly enhanced my skills to……….. • I have enclosed …. • You can always contact me via e-mail (abc@gmail.com) or phone (0431082300), if deemed necessary, for future correspondence regarding ……. http://www.smartielts.org
